January 25, 2011. The fall of Ben Ali in Tunis on January 14, 2011, built beacons of hope in the Arab world. All the attention is in Egypt, where groups in solidarity with the young Alexandrian Khaled Said, killed by the police, are calling for Egyptians to take to the streets against the regime. The chosen date is January 25, National Police Day, seen as one of the pillars of a regime sustained for decades in the country and ruled by Mohammed Hosny Mubarak as a Western ally. But people, claiming freedom and social justice, breaks the barrier of fear, goes outside and begins a rebellion that will shake the whole world. Erhal - Leave - chronicles from within the 18-days-struggle that brought down one of the more stable dictators of the Middle East.
UntitledA documentary on Radio Pica, a Barcelona radio station that has been operating since 1981, was closed by the Generalitat in 1987 and was back on the air waves in 1990. Barcelona independent radio - a quarter of a century powering communication that is truly alternative, not subordinate to commercial ends.
UntitledAn interview with Uruguayan writer and journalist Eduard Galeano, who spoke at the Acampadabcn assembly on May 23, 2011. “There is another world beating inside this one, a world that is different and seemingly difficult. It will not easily be born, but its definitely beating in this present world, and I sense its presence in these spontaneous demonstrations: in Plaça Catalunya in Barcelona, in Sol in Madrid (...) People ask me: “What's going to happen now?.. What’s next?... What will become of this?” And I can only answer from my own experience. I say: “Well... nothing... I don’t know what’s going to happen, and it doesn’t really matter to me. All I care about are the things that are happening now, the present moment, and what this moment augurs about another moment that will come into being, although I do not know how it will be. It would be as if, every time I had an experience of love, I asked myself what was going to happen next."

UntitledThe documentary "Between the book and the sword" portrays the Sikh community in the city of Barcelona and its surroundings, showing the contrast between the bustle and volatility of the city and a solid community with permanent social and cultural structures. Through the stories of some of its members, their flavors and the striking colors that fill the screen, we capture the intimacy of private space, the space of worship and prayer, and finally the occupation of public space. This film does not intend to show the totality of the Sikh community, but rather fragments of lived scenes that transport the viewer into an ethnographic experience. This video is part of the Educational Agreement of collaboration between the OVNI Archives and the Department of Anthropology of the University of Barcelona - UAB , for the curricular external practices of the students, of the academic year 2022-2023.
